The passenger segment is estimated to witness significant growth during the forecast period.
The European aviation market is experiencing significant growth, driven by the increasing number of air travelers due to economic growth and rising disposable incomes. In Q1 2023, 179 million passengers were carried across the EU, representing a 56% increase over Q1 2022. This trend continued throughout the year, with approximately 820 million people opting for air travel in 2022. Europe's popularity as a tourist destination attracts millions of visitors annually. To accommodate this surge in demand, full-service carriers and low-cost carriers are expanding their fleets, leading to an increased need for aircraft acquisition and maintenance. Market Dynamics of Airline Industry Market
Key Drivers for Airline Industry Market
Increased demand for air cargo to propel market growth
Increased demand for air cargo is a key driver of growth in the airline sector market. The advent of e-commerce, combined with global supply chain integration, has increased the demand for rapid and dependable delivery services. Airlines are profiting from this trend by increasing cargo capacity, investing in specialist freighter aircraft, and improving logistics. Furthermore, the increased importance of carrying high-value, time-sensitive items like medications and electronics drives up demand. By focusing on air cargo, airlines may diversify income streams, increase profitability, and reduce the volatility of passenger travel demand, ensuring long-term market growth.
Growing technological advancements to propel market growth
Technological advances are expected to drive significant expansion in the airline sector market. Aircraft design innovations, such as more fuel-efficient engines and lightweight materials, help to minimize operational costs and environmental effects. Advanced avionics and navigation systems increase safety and efficiency, while digital technologies such as artificial intelligence and big data analytics improve route planning, maintenance, and customer service. The use of automation in ticketing, check-in, and baggage processing enhances both the passenger experience and operational efficiency. Furthermore, the use of in-flight connections and individualized entertainment selections improves client happiness. Airlines that embrace these technological innovations can raise competitiveness, save costs, and satisfy changing consumer expectations, resulting in long-term market growth and profitability.
Restraint Factor for the Airline Industry Market
Volatility in Fuel Prices
Jet fuel costs account for a significant portion of an airline's operating expenses. Since global oil prices are highly unpredictable and influenced by geopolitical events, inflation, and supply chain disruptions, even small fluctuations can heavily impact profitability. Airlines operating on thin margins often struggle to absorb sudden price increases, especially low-cost carriers.
Regulatory and Environmental Compliance Pressure
Airlines face increasingly stringent regulations related to emissions, noise pollution, and operational safety—especially in regions like the EU and North America. Compliance with these regulations often requires substantial investment in new technology, fleet upgrades, and reporting infrastructure, which increases operational costs and delays profitability.

By Component Insights
The software segment is estimated to witness significant growth during the forecast period. Artificial Intelligence (AI) plays a pivotal role in the aerospace sector, particularly in the airline industry and airports. Cloud-based technologies facilitate the implementation of AI solutions, including machine learning, in various aviation applications. AI software streamlines operations in the aviation industry, with the software segment witnessing significant growth. In the airline industry, AI is utilized for flight planning and optimization, predictive maintenance, and air traffic management. Flight planning software uses AI algorithms to determine optimal flight routes, thereby reducing fuel consumption and improving flight efficiency. Predictive maintenance software analyzes aircraft data to anticipate maintenance requirements, thereby minimizing downtime and operational disruptions.
Additionally, air traffic management software optimizes air traffic flow, reducing congestion and enhancing airspace utilization. Moreover, AI-based chatbots offer customer service solutions, providing real-time support and streamlining passenger interactions. In the aviation industry, AI applications extend to crew management, where software assists in optimizing crew assignments and scheduling, ensuring operational smoothness. In the aviation industry, North America led the global market for AI technologies in 2023, driven by the adoption of Internet of Things (IoT), big data, and factory automation. The aerospace sector's heightened reliance on data analytics and cloud-based applications further fueled this growth. In the US, airports employ AI remote security technology to enhance security, with plans to install six ROSA180 units for detecting and deterring unauthorized access to parking garages and secure areas. The general aviation market is segmented by aircraft type into fixed-wing and rotorcraft. Fixed-wing aircraft, including small jets and turboprops, are commonly used for business and private travel due to their speed, range, and comfort. The demand for fixed-wing aircraft is driven by their versatility and efficiency in operations, making them ideal for both short and long-haul flights. Fixed-wing aircraft also benefit from continuous technological advancements, such as the development of more fuel-efficient engines and improved aerodynamics, which enhance their performance and reduce operating costs.
Rotorcraft, which include helicopters, play a crucial role in applications requiring vertical takeoff and landing capabilities. They are extensively used in medical services, search and rescue operations, and offshore transportation. The flexibility and maneuverability of rotorcraft make them indispensable in areas with limited infrastructure. Recent innovations in rotorcraft technology, such as the incorporation of advanced avionics and the development of quieter and more efficient engines, are enhancing their operational capabilities and boosting their adoption in various sectors.
